Today I thought I would give you something a bit different and put to you a Double page scrap layout with photos of my adult neice and nephew when they were children.  I hope they forgive me. 🙂

Sometimes older photos given by family to an aunt are not the best for anything, but I am happy with the result of this.  And of course I did my usual flower and bling stuff with it!!

 

 

 

Both pages were started with Bazzill Canvas Fawn, sponge inked around the edge and textured with an aging stamp cube and the word frinds. An 8×8 panel in Bazzill Canvas Vanilla, stamped with background stamps around the edge in placed in the centre of both pages.  Designer paper is torn, inked and rolled to give that burned appearance.

Photos cropped and placed, then the title tiles on both pages and then the flowers and bling till done.  Oh yes the ribbon too.
